Dilations Notes Video Links & WebWith a dilation, every point on a figure and the corresponding point on the dilated image of the figure should be collinear with the center of dilation, as Sal explains in the video. Point C matches with one of the endpoints of triangle N and its image, but it has to match every single point to be the center of dilation.
